Re: apt-get bails with this error...



On Fri, 23 Jul 1999, Mark Wagnon wrote:

> I was installing upgrading one of my machines to potato, and
> apt-get did what I thought was its business, but it seemed too
> short of a period of time for it to finish. I did an apt-get
> upgrade (assuming I was officially at the potato level) and
> apt-get gives me this:
> 
>    E: Size mismatch for package fdflush
> 
> I re-installed fdflush by hand, but that didn't work. Any ideas?
> Should I try to install a package from another mirror?

This will only happen if APT went to download a package and what it
downloaded was the wrong size - ie your mirror is busted. If you run
apt-get again then it will perform a resume operation, assuming that the
mirror you are using is in the process of downloading it.

Otherwise use another mirror - you may or may not have to erase
/var/cache/apt/archives/partial/* by hand - it depends on what was wrong
with your mirror and what apt version you are using. (0.3.11 will recover
fully if you run it enough times ;>)
